Transaction 51d5bacac55d2630ab985f8ecf59fa000fe7bc785f5f1146b71aafad4914a057
1 Input
1 Output
-
51d5bacac55d2630ab985f8ecf59fa000fe7bc785f5f1146b71aafad4914a057:0
- value
- 20070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df80fcec8c850dca57e4973caa3f55a08268202e OP_EQUAL
- address
- 3N4o8ZgGtxUhyvo2sy9tTwELzD7pXsKA6u